I am new to PowerApps so any specific detail provided would be appreciated.
I have a basic form created using PowerApps. If I edit an existing record using my form, hit save and then that record again the change I just made does not display. I do, however, see that my data (using a SP list) is correct. If I refresh my browser and then open the record I see the edit. Also, if I wait a few minutes before I edit the form again the new data will appear.
Is there a way to ensure the data has been refreshed prior to opening an edit form?

Hi @KCM
SubmitForm(Form1);Refresh(DataSourceName)
